The Mechanics Behind AI Voiceovers
At the heart of AI voiceovers lies a sophisticated network of neural networks. These networks are trained to recognize the intricate patterns in human speech, including prosody, rhythm, and intonation. Once trained, the AI can generate new voice recordings that sound remarkably human. This process involves several stages:
Data Collection and Training: AI systems are fed vast amounts of audio data. This data includes various accents, dialects, and emotional states to learn the subtleties of human speech.
Voice Synthesis: Using this training, AI can generate new voice recordings. The synthesis process is refined through iterative feedback, ensuring that the output maintains a high level of realism.
Fine-Tuning: Post-generation, the AI can be fine-tuned to produce specific characteristics, such as a particular age group’s voice, regional accents, or even celebrity impressions.

AI Voiceovers: A Technological Marvel
AI voiceover technology has reached a level of sophistication that can convincingly mimic human speech. This capability is largely due to advancements in machine learning, natural language processing, and deep learning. Key components of this technology include:
Neural Text-to-Speech (TTS) Models: These models convert text into speech using neural networks. They learn the patterns in human speech from large datasets and can generate natural-sounding voices.
Voice Cloning: This process involves creating a digital replica of a person’s voice based on a limited amount of audio data. Voice cloning technology can then generate new speech that sounds like the original speaker.
Emotional Intelligence: AI is being developed to understand and replicate emotional nuances in speech. This is achieved through the integration of sentiment analysis and advanced machine learning techniques.
